var openid = ""; //定义了一个全局变量在Page外
//获取用户openId,然后写了个函数把用户的openid存进全局变量
getSysId() {
wx.cloud.callFunction({
name: 'getWxSysIdFunc',
})
.then(res => {
console.log("查询openid成功", res.result.openid)
openid = res.result.openid
//console.log(openid)
})
.catch(res => {
console.log("查询openid失败", res.result)
})
},
//然后写了个BUTTON的点击事件
wechatLogin() {
this.getSysId()
let userSysOpenid = openid
console.log(userSysOpenid)
console.log(openid)
问题来了,为啥执行时会出现这样
求大腿们帮忙解答下,谢谢。